Agricultural machinery manufacturers have spent years digitizing equipment operations, vacuuming up field performance logs, machine diagnostics, and agronomic records. That telemetry is now shifting from passive dashboards into interactive enterprise interfaces. John Deere has initiated closed testing for a proprietary AI assistant called JD, designed to convert operational archives into real-time operational guidance for machinery operators.

Machine Data as an Advisory Layer

Testing is currently active for select US customers within the John Deere Operations Center. Acting as a specialized retrieval-augmented loop over farm histories and live sensor feeds, the tool evaluates historical patterns alongside real-time machinery telemetry to resolve operational bottlenecks: pinpointing optimal equipment calibrations, curbing fuel burn, and dialing in harvest timing to avert multimillion-dollar seasonal downtime.

"John Deere is testing a new 'JD' AI assistant that it says can help farmers make more money, with answers about best practices and historical trends that are based on their own data."

According to company documentation, John Deere claims this advisory layer directly boosts financial margins. Following initial web and mobile availability, the manufacturer plans to bake the assistant directly into in-cab tractor displays while preparing specialized iterations for roadbuilding, forestry, construction, and turf fleets.

Governance and Data Lock-In

To manage persistent friction with customers and antitrust regulators, John Deere paired its early access rollout with formal governance pledges. After protracted disputes with farmers and the Federal Trade Commission over "Right to Repair" restrictions, the company published a 10-point Farmer Data Commitment.

The framework explicitly pledges that John Deere will not sell farm data, prohibits utilizing customer datasets for commodity speculation, and allows users to sever third-party data streams. John Deere maintains that it pairs customer operational logs with aggregated, anonymized fleet telemetry solely to sharpen predictive maintenance and operational insights. The exact model weights powering JD remain undisclosed, yet the underlying enterprise logic is clear: proprietary industrial telemetry creates a vertical moat that generic commodity LLMs cannot breach.

While John Deere pledges that operators retain formal authority over their records, extracting actionable machine intelligence still demands feeding every acre of proprietary telemetry right back into the closed ecosystem regulators have spent years attempting to dismantle.
